Nanga School Painting
• Inspired by new Confucianism in Japanese, ancient Chinese literati, and individualism.
• Made work unique by blending Chinese models (literati), Japanese aesthetics, and personal expression.

Zen Painting
• Because of the rising support and following of neo-Confusionism, Zen Buddhism declined a little.
• Revived by Hakuin Ekaku,who was a devout, enlightened Zen Buddhist and painted everyday subjects to be easily understood.
• Known for his humor and charm in later years• Hakuin’s pupils followed through brushwork,
becoming Zen masters again!• “What is the sound of one hand clapping?” - koan
(mysterious Zen riddle)

Hakuin Ekaku• Bodhidharma
Meditating• Edo Period, 18th c.• Ink on paper• 9th year of meditation
for the Bodhidharma• Intensity, concentration,
and spiritual depth are conveyed by thick brush strokes.
• “Pointing directly to the human heart, see your own nature and become Buddha.”
